Construction has just been completed on the second complete system installation. This was a fairly tricky installation as if was about 50km from the main town centre, so we had to be sure that we had everything on hand ready for the installation. The truck was hired and packed the night before, and growbed irrigation was all cut to size ready for installation. It was about an hour and a half drive, and by the time we got there in the morning and started to unload ready for construction it was about 10.30. There was Faye, Monya and myself doing the installation and we had most of the main construction completed by around 3.30. Another couple of hours fiddling with little bits, getting the flows right to the beds, and return pump set correctly, we left the site by around 5.30, with one very happy customer.. We did forget one fitting, a simple 32mm threaded fitting, that the lady who we were installing it for drove down to the local hardware store to get.. And when I say local, I mean she had to do a 60km round trip to get it. The system is a simple 4 bed, flood and drain, with large drain/fingerling tank, and it worked a treat, with very little adjustments of valves from the first time we switched it on..

nah, she has some raised vegie beds. hydroton floats on first flood, then settles down. One flood with pulgs in, run to waste after a good soak, then water ran a bit pink, but should settle out nicely IMHO. Certainly a pleasure to work with as opposed to gravel, and if you can afford it, it's a great way to go. |
